The t-shirt features the faces of three of our most prominent air aces.

Lieutenant Nedelcho Ivanov Bonchev is a Bulgarian fighter pilot. He is known as the second Bulgarian pilot who shot down an American bomber during World War II.

General Stoyan Stoyanov is the Bulgarian ace with the most aerial victories. Three times awarded with the order "For Bravery" (the first awarded with the order after the Treaty of Neuilly).

Dimitar Svetosarov Spisarevski is a Bulgarian officer, fighter pilot. During his lifetime he was a lieutenant, posthumously promoted to captain, 1944, and colonel, in 2009). He is a Knight of the Order of Valor (posthumous). Died during a combat flight during the bombing of Sofia in World War II, after shooting down an American B-24 bomber with an aerial ram.

The Battle of Bulair was fought in the area of Bulair and the old fortress of Tsimpe. The Bulgarian Seventh Rila Infantry Division under the command of Major General Georgi Todorov and the Ottoman Muretebi Division and the Twenty-seventh Infantry Division under the command of Ali Fethi Okyar meet on the battlefield. In honor of Bulgaria's victory, the march "Bulaire" was written.
On the right, northern flank, there are Rila, on the left, larger and more difficult, bombarded with artillery and from the sea side, Thracians. They are supported by the 7th Rapid Fire Artillery Regiment. The Turks go on the offensive as early as 6 o'clock in the morning. Their raids are directed mainly against the left flank of the Bulgarians.
Late in the evening, after twelve hours of fighting, the Murtebna and the 27th Nizam's Divisions were driven back to where they had left early in the morning. Only with 6000 less! So many were killed - 4 thousand before the 22nd regiment and 2 thousand before the 13th regiment. The total losses of the Bulgarians were three officers from the 22nd regiment and 118 soldiers, the wounded were a total of 6 officers and 483 soldiers. In the skirmishes, the flag of the Turkish combat unit was captured by the non-commissioned officer of the 22nd regiment Dimitar Terziyski from the village of Shiroki dol, close to Samokov. And in November 1914, it was returned to where it belongs - in Samokov.
